What is Whole Exome Sequencing?

Whole Exome Sequencing (WES) is a genetic test that analyzes all the protein-coding regions of a person’s DNA — known as the exome. While the exome makes up only about 1–2% of the human genome, it contains 85% of known disease-causing mutations.

WES helps identify mutations that are responsible for rare genetic disorders, developmental delays, and other complex conditions by sequencing these exonic regions using Next-Generation Sequencing (NGS).


How Does Whole Exome Sequencing Work?

Here’s a simplified step-by-step process:

  1. DNA Extraction
    A sample of your (or your child’s) DNA is collected via a simple blood or saliva sample.
  2. Library Preparation
    The DNA is broken into fragments, and exons are targeted using special probes.
  3. NGS Sequencing
    The selected exons are sequenced using advanced NGS platforms.
  4. Data Analysis
    The patient’s sequence is compared to a reference genome to identify differences.
  5. Report Generation
    Experts analyze the data and prepare a detailed clinical report, highlighting relevant genetic variants.

Who Should Get WES?

Whole Exome Sequencing is recommended if:

  • A genetic condition is suspected but not yet diagnosed
  • The patient has a complex medical history involving multiple organs or symptoms
  • Previous genetic tests were inconclusive
  • There is a family history of genetic disorders
  • You’re planning to have children and want genetic screening

WES can be done in prenatal, pediatric, or adult cases.

What’s Included in the WES Report?

  • Primary Findings: Disease-related genetic variants relevant to your or your child’s condition.
  • Secondary Findings (optional): Other clinically significant mutations that may impact long-term health.
  • Variants of Uncertain Significance (VUS): Mutations with unknown or unclear clinical effects.
  • Family Testing Guidance: Information to help test relatives if a genetic variant is found.
  • 📁 Raw Data Provided: You will receive the raw FASTQ/VCF/BAM data files upon request for future use, research, or second opinions.

📌 Note: Raw data can be large (in GBs) and is usually shared via a secure cloud link or external storage.

WES vs. Other Genetic Tests

Test TypeGenome CoverageBest For
Whole Exome Sequencing~2% (All exons)Complex, undiagnosed conditions
Whole Genome Sequencing100%Ultra-rare diseases, research use
Targeted Gene Panels10–200 genesKnown disease groups (e.g. cancer, epilepsy)
Microarray / KaryotypingChromosomal levelLarge deletions/duplications

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)

Is WES better than normal genetic testing?

Yes. Traditional tests target 1–10 genes, while WES analyzes over 20,000 coding genes, increasing the chance of finding a diagnosis.

Can I use WES for family planning?

Absolutely. It can detect inherited conditions and help assess risks for future children.

Can WES be done during pregnancy?

Yes, prenatal exome sequencing can help diagnose fetal anomalies, usually in high-risk pregnancies.

What if no mutation is found?

A negative result doesn’t rule out a genetic cause. Additional tests or updates may be considered later as research evolves.
